概括
研究人员使用计算方法设计了针对表皮生长因子受体 (EGFR) 的新型抗体模拟剂. 这些小蛋白质结合剂通过模仿具有高结合亲和力的单克隆抗体,显示出对癌症治疗的前途.

背景情况:
- 单克隆抗体是关键的治疗药物,通过互补决定区域 (CDR) 结合目标.
- 具有保存的CDRs的小蛋白质提供了作为抗体模拟剂的潜力.
- 表皮生长因子受体 (EGFR) 是一种重要的癌症标志物.
研究的目的:
- 使用CDR移植设计针对EGFR的新型抗体模拟剂.
- 为了确定有效的小蛋白质支架用于CDR固定.
- 通过计算评估设计模仿剂与EGFR域III的结合亲和力.
主要方法:
- 在三个小蛋白质支架和十个移植受体位点的in silico选择.
- 使用从panitumumab抗体中循环随机化的CDR移植技术.
- 具有约束力的能量计算,以评估EGFR DIII相互作用.
主要成果:
- 在36种组合中确定了三个有前途的抗体仿真候选者.
- 通过计算分析证明了对EGFR域III的特定结合.
- 选择的脚手架显示了移植的CDR循环的高效固定.
结论:
- CDR移植策略和精选的小蛋白质支架对于设计新的EGFR结合剂是有效的.
- 开发的抗体模拟剂表现出高的结合能,表明治疗潜力.
- 这种计算方法加速了针对癌症的向治疗方法的发现.

Hematopoietic growth factors are molecules that regulate the differentiation rate of hematopoietic stem cells (HSCs). Erythropoietin (EPO), primarily produced by the kidneys, plays a crucial role in erythrocyte production. When oxygen levels in the blood are low, EPO is released into the bloodstream, reaching the bone marrow, where it stimulates HSCs to differentiate and mature into erythrocytes, which are vital for oxygen transport.

Microorganisms are classified as acidophiles, neutrophiles, or alkaliphiles based on their pH growth preferences, reflecting their adaptations to specific environments. Maintaining a stable intracellular pH is critical for macromolecular stability and enzymatic activity, which can be challenged by external pH variations.Neutrophiles, such as Escherichia coli, grow optimally between pH 5.5 and 8.0. Microorganisms display remarkable adaptations, enabling them to thrive in diverse ecological niches across a wide range of temperatures. Temperature profoundly influences microbial growth by affecting enzymatic activity, membrane fluidity, and other cellular processes.Each microorganism operates within a specific temperature range defined by three cardinal points: minimum, optimum, and maximum. Osmolarity is the measure of solute concentration in a solution. It plays a critical role in determining water availability for organisms. Water moves across semipermeable membranes through osmosis, flowing from regions of lower solute concentration (more dilute) to regions of higher solute concentration (more concentrated).In high-solute environments, microbial cells lose water, leading to dehydration and inhibited growth. Tissue-specific transcription factors contribute to diverse cellular functions in mammals. For example, the gene for beta globin, a major component of hemoglobin, is present in all cells of the body. However, it is only expressed in red blood cells because the transcription factors that can bind to the promoter sequences of the beta globin gene are only expressed in these cells.
